Shahrak-e Gol Beyk (Persian: شهرک گل بيک; also known as Shahrak-e Gol Beyg)[1] is a village in Dust Mohammad Rural District, in the Central District of Hirmand County, Sistan and Baluchestan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 521, in 106 families.[2]
